8.5.5 "In height" level selection
Calibration with reference pressure (wet calibration)
Example:
In this example, the volume in a tank should be measured in liters. The maximum volume of
1000 liters (264 US gal) corresponds to a level of 4.5 m (15 ft). The minimum volume of 0 liters
corresponds to a level of 0.5 m (1.6 ft) since the device is mounted below the start of the level
measuring range.
The density of the medium is 1 g/cm
3
(1 SGU).
Prerequisite:
The measured variable is in direct proportion to the pressure.
The tank can be filled and emptied.
The values entered for "Empty calib./Full calib.", " Set LRV/Set URV" and the pressures present at
the device must be at least 1% apart. The value will be rejected, and a warning message
displayed, if the values are too close together. Other limit values are not checked, i.e. the values
entered must be appropriate for the sensor and the measuring task for the device to be able to
measure correctly.
